PBT PET強化充填低温強化剤

モデル番号:W510

はじめに

W510はポリエステル強靭化剤であり、ポリエステル合金相溶化剤でもあります。W510は、PBT/PET強化充填剤、低温強靭化改質剤、ポリオレフィンおよびポリエステル合金の相溶化剤に使用でき、高いコストパフォーマンスを発揮します!
パフォーマンス 価値 試験方法
密度 0.89g/cm ASTM D792
Melt Flow Rate (190℃/2.16kg) 2-6g/10min ASTM D1238
エポキシ基含有量 高い COACEメソッド¹。
水分 ≤0.3% ハロゲン迅速水分測定
Note: The above data are typical test values ​​and should not be interpreted as specifications.

商品説明

 

W510 is both a polyester toughening agent and a polyester alloy compatibilizer. It is a high-performance graft copolymer mainly used to strengthen polyethylene terephthalate (PET) and polybutadiene- Low temperature toughness of butadiene-styrene (PBT) alloys. This product is made by grafting glycidyl methacrylate (GMA) functional groups on the polyolefin elastomer (POE) matrix, and has significant mechanical properties improvement and low temperature resistance.

Designed to improve PBT and PET polymers’ toughness and flexibility at low temperatures, W510 is Its special formulation with GMA functional groups guarantees strong interfacial bonding with many surfaces; the polyolefin elastomer matrix offers a basis for remarkable elasticity and endurance. Experimental tests show that the impact strength and elongation at break of PBT and PET modified by adding W510 filling are significantly improved, and the materials modified by adding W510 show good toughness.
